Easy Deploy Bundle Wunderfork Laravel Package

djamadeus/easy-deploy-bundle-wunderfork

When to Consider This Package

Adopt this package if:

  • Your team uses Symfony 2.7+ and prioritizes PHP-native deployment tools over external dependencies (e.g., Python, Ruby).
  • You need multi-server, multi-stage deployments with zero downtime and no complex YAML/XML/JSON configs.
  • Your infrastructure already supports SSH access and PHP 7.1+ on remote servers (no provisioning required).
  • You lack dedicated DevOps resources or prefer lightweight, self-contained deployment logic.

Look elsewhere if:

  • Your stack includes containerized applications (e.g., Docker/Kubernetes) or requires server provisioning (use Ansible/Terraform instead).
  • You need advanced deployment strategies (e.g., blue-green, canary) beyond zero-downtime releases.
  • Your team prefers modern CI/CD tools (e.g., GitHub Actions, GitLab CI) with built-in deployment pipelines.
  • The package’s last release (2017) is a concern for long-term maintenance (evaluate alternatives like Deployer or Symfony’s Mercury).
